Strapped for cash? Follow these tips and there will be no need to ask the ‘rents!

  1. Start a service. Why not try asking your friends to start janitorial services in your community or even at school? You’re not only helping Mother Nature to be clean and green but also yourself about getting paid. See? Hitting two birds with just a stone.
  2. Design web layouts. If you enjoy making and customizing Multiply and WordPress themes or layouts and you do it rather well, why not profit from it? Fees can start small and increase if clients want more customization. Most establishments have a web page or site, and a good design is vital for attracting viewers. Try e-mailing online stores, blog communities, or non-profit websites that you believe need layout makeovers, and offer to do it for a minimal fee.
  3. Organize a garage sale. Collect clothes, accessories, and random things that don’t fit, haven’t been used, or are not at all functional. Try asking your friends to help you out by donating their items, too. Publicize it via e-mail and text, or create posters before the event itself. Make it fun by putting up a mini-concessionaire area with finger-food, fruit punch, and dessert.
